Florida Inst. of Education, Jacksonville. – 1988
The conference addressed a trend in the education of minority students in Florida and the nation. While high school graduation rates of minorities have increased, minority enrollment in postsecondary education has decreased. A statewide study of 811 randomly selected high school seniors was undertaken to identify variables which may influence a…
